Uzbekistan's Rapid Industrial Growth & The Evolution of Prefabricated Helidecks

The Context: Industrial Modernization and High-Altitude Accessibility

Uzbekistan is undergoing an unprecedented infrastructure development phase. Guided by strategic urban planning programs like Tashkent City expansion and regional industrialization mandates in Samarkand, Navoiy, and Zarafshan, structural engineers are turning to lightweight, high-performance structural aluminum profiles. The shift is replacing heavy, labor-intensive concrete structures in favor of prefabricated systems.

Particularly for helicopter landing systems, high-altitude installations on hospitals, commercial towers, and remote gas extraction fields demand weight reduction without compromising structural safety. Rigid structural steel or solid concrete helipads exert immense dead load on buildings, demanding massive foundations and seismic structural enhancements. In a region with high seismic activity such as Tashkent, reducing building dead weight is a critical engineering priority.

Why High-Strength Aluminum Alloys?

Aluminum helipads utilize grade 6005A-T6 or 6082-T6 aluminum extrusions. These structural alloys are optimized for tensile properties, weldability, and corrosion resistance. Let's look at the primary reasons global engineering firms demand aluminum helipads:

  • Excellent Strength-to-Weight Ratio: Extruded aluminum weighs approximately 60% less than structural steel and up to 80% less than reinforced concrete decks, maintaining high structural rigidity.
  • Corrosion Resistance: High continental climates in Central Asia run the gamut of temperature fluctuations. Marine-grade and industrial-grade aluminum profiles develop natural oxide layers, preventing rust and negating maintenance costs.
  • Rapid Interlocking Design: Modular planks slip together with tight tolerances, allowing assembly in a matter of days rather than weeks. This reduces local on-site crane costs and engineering overhead.

How to Estimate Your Helipad Aluminum Profile Budget in Uzbekistan

Purchasing an aluminum helideck system involves several key factors that influence the final factory invoice and shipping calculations. When asking for a pricelist, our engineering department calculates prices based on four key metrics:

1. Aluminum Grade & Metric Tonnage

Prices follow international raw aluminum ingot pricing index (LME). High-performance alloys like 6082-T6 and 6005A-T6 cost slightly more than standard commercial 6063 grades, but offer higher tensile strength.

2. Anodizing Thickness & Finish

Continental environments (extreme summer heat/winter cold) require protective coating. Deep anodizing (15-25 microns) or specialized fluorocarbon paint increases the lifespan but adds to the processing cost.

3. Custom Extrusion Dies

Standard profile sizes utilize existing extrusion dies from our factory. Custom section designs (up to 1.2m wide) require tooling and calibration, which are priced based on development complexities.

Why is aluminum preferred over concrete for rooftop helipads in seismic zones like Tashkent?
Concrete helipads add massive structural weight to a building. In earthquake-prone zones, additional mass increases seismic loading forces significantly. An aluminum deck is up to 80% lighter than concrete, minimizing seismic strain on columns and foundation beams.
